Roast Tomato & Veg Pasta ???? #shorts
If you’ve been here from the start you’ll know this recipe well- it’s from my very first book in 2009, GOOD MOOD FOOD! Sign of a good one as I still come back to it time and time again. I’ve been making versions of it forever and the one main reason is because of its simplicity. You roast tomatoes and garlic and whatever summer veggies, add warm pasta to the roasting tin, toss to get everything acquainted and serve straight to the table! Batch cook it for your dinners this week! x
Serves: 4
200g plum & cherry tomatoes, sliced in half
1 red onion, quartered
3 small courgettes, cut into 3cm cubes
1 bulb garlic, roots cut off
2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
1 tbsp balsamic vingar
350g green beans, cut into 5cm pieces
200g rigatoni
Sea salt & freshly ground black pepper
Parmesan, to serve
Basil leaves, to serve
1. Preheat the oven to 200°C/180°C fan/400°F/Gas Mark 6.
2. Arrange the tomatoes, courgette, red onions and garlic in separate piles across a medium-sized roasting tin with high sides. Drizzle over the olive oil and balsamic vinegar and season with salt and pepper. Give everything a good toss to make sure it’s all coated evenly, then place in the oven to roast on the middle shelf for 30 minutes.
3. About 10 minutes before the vegetables are finished cooking, cook the pasta in a large pan of boiling salted water until al dente. About halfway through the boiling of the pasta, add in the green beans.
4. Remove the roasting tin from the oven and carefully squeeze the mushy garlic out of the skins on to the tomatoes; discard the skins. Using the back of a fork, mash down the garlic and tomatoes until combined. Add a ladle of the pasta cooking liquid to this and stir to make a sauce. Now mix all of the contents of the pan together and then pour in the drained pasta.
5. Add some generous shavings of Parmesan and roughly tear in a few basil leaves. Toss everything together until well combined and serve hot, garnished with more Parmesan shavings and basil leaves

SPICY ROASTED ZUCCHINI PASTA
INGREDIENTS
1 pound pasta - ziti, rigatoni, penne, etc
1/2 cup olive oil
1 28 ounce can high quality plum tomatoes
5 medium to small zucchini - seeds scooped out and cut into half moons
1 medium onion, diced
4 Cloves of garlic - sliced
2 cups smoked mozzarella - cubed
¼ cup Pecorino Romano cheese - grated
¼ cup packed basil leaves - chopped
¼ cup parsley - minced
1 teaspoon Calabrian chili paste - plus more to taste
Salt and pepper - to taste
1.Toss zucchini with a 1/4 cup of olive oil and spread out on a baking sheet. Sprinkle with salt and pepper and roast zucchini for 20-25 minutes at 450f on lowest oven rack or until well browned.
2. Meanwhile, bring a large pot of salted water (2 tablespoons kosher salt) to boil.
3. In a very large pan saute the onions in a ¼ cup of olive oil over medium-low heat until translucent (about 3- 5 minutes) then add the garlic and cook for 2 minutes more until golden. Add the Calabrian chili paste into the oil and cook for 30 more seconds.
4.Add the tomatoes to the pan and bring sauce to a simmer.
5. While the sauce is simmering, cook the pasta until al dente.
6.Taste test the sauce and adjust salt and pepper to taste. Add the pasta and roasted zucchini to the sauce and toss to coat. Cook for 60 seconds, then turn off the heat. If the pasta is too dry add a splash of pasta water. Add the basil and Pecorino Romano cheese and mix together.
7.Add the cubed mozzarella cheese. Toss once more and serve immediately with more Pecorino Romano and Calabrian chili paste on the side. Enjoy!
